The Pricing and Policy Division works across a range of sectors including water, energy, public transport, local government as well as other sectors requested by the NSW Government. Policy analysts regularly rotate across projects based on their interests and experience.
Some examples of current and future projects you may work on are:
- Determining maximum price limits for water utilities including Sydney Water, Hunter Water and WaterNSW, to ensure customers pay only what an efficient water utility would need to deliver high-quality, reliable, and safe water services
- Reviewing the methodology to set the limit on the total amount that NSW local councils can increase their income from rates each year
- Setting maximum fares for Opal public transport services, aiming to maximise the value NSW gets from its public transport network
- Reviewing the early childhood education and care sector in NSW and making recommendations to the NSW Government to improve accessibility, affordability and choice
- Developing a levy to fund the efficient cost of dams safety regulation in NSW.

The Independent Pricing & Regulatory Tribunal (IPART) makes the people of NSW better off through its independent decisions and advice. We help people get safe and reliable services at a fair price. We act with integrity and courage, curiosity and openness, respect and inclusion to make a difference for NSW.
IPART undertakes independent regulatory functions in the water, transport, local government and energy sectors in NSW. We also undertake reviews and make recommendations on a wide range of economic and social policy matters at the NSW Government’s request.
